Carbon, the Building Block of Brilliance

At the heart of every lab diamond lies the elemental foundation of carbon. Unlike their natural counterparts, which form deep within the Earth’s mantle over millions of years, lab diamonds are created through advanced technological processes that mimic the natural diamond-growing environment. By subjecting carbon atoms to extreme pressure and temperature conditions, scientists can initiate the crystallization process, resulting in the formation of pure carbon crystals with remarkable clarity and brilliance.

The Role of Trace Elements: Enhancing Beauty and Color

While carbon serves as the primary constituent of lab diamonds, their composition may also include trace elements that contribute to their unique coloration. By introducing specific impurities during the growth process, such as boron for blue hues or nitrogen for yellow tones, diamond manufacturers can tailor the color profile of Composicion de diamantes de laboratorio to meet the diverse preferences of consumers. This precise control over coloration distinguishes lab diamonds as customizable works of art, offering a spectrum of shades to suit every taste.
